BRANTFORD BROTHERS GEARING UP FOR BUSY RACING SEASON

Mitch and Jake Brown Eyeing Championships in 2015
The opening of the local motorsports scene is still a few weeks away and for racing brothers Mitch and Jake Brown of Brantford, they can hardly wait to fire up the engines in their winged-open-wheel race cars at Ohsweken Speedway.
The local track south of Brantford has scheduled its pre-season test and tune session for May 8th with the opening of its 20th season of weekly Friday night racing beginning on Friday, May 15 and both brothers will be there.
Mitch Brown actually began his 2015 Sprint Car season back in February with five nights of racing in the Sunshine state…not a bad place to test the refreshed equipment and sharpen the reflexes following 3-1/2 months of relative inactivity since his 2014 season ended.
But the February laps he ran in practice and in fierce competition at Tampa’s East Bay Raceway Park and Ocala’s Bubba Raceway Park were simply a warm-up for the hectic schedule he’s plotted into his Sprint Car racing calendar for 2015.
With 56 events spread among seven Southern Ontario tracks and eleven ovals in 5 states south of the border, Mitch and his Brantford-based team know they have a tough challenge ahead of them.
Included in those 56 events are 34 counting towards three championships in three series – Ohsweken Speedway’s Corr/Pak Merchandising 360 Sprint Car Division; the Southern Ontario Sprints championship; and the Canadian portion of the US-based Patriot Sprint Tour’s cross-border championship.
Last season Mitch was runner-up to Glenn Styres in both Ohsweken’s and the SOS championship races and was fourth in the PST’s Canadian series final standings.
Before Ohsweken Speedway’s opener on May 15, Mitch is scheduled to begin his spring season with three National Racing Alliance events at Limaland Motorsports Park at Lima, Ohio and three Patriot Sprint Tour races with stops at Merrittville Speedway (Thorold, ON), Canandaigua Motorsports Park in the Finger Lakes Region of New York State and Woodhull Raceway in the Southern Tier of New York State west of Corning.
Also on Mitch’s busy schedule are two events against the Empire Super Sprints, the World of Outlaws annual race at Ohsweken Speedway on July 3rd and the annual Canadian Sprint Car Nationals at Ohsweken in mid-September.
His season will wrap up in October with the UNOH Sprintacular at Tony Stewart’s Eldora Speedway in Ohio and two American Sprint Car Series events at Devil’s Bowl Speedway, Mesquite, Texas and I-30 Speedway at Little Rock, Arkansas.
JAKE BROWN SET TO RETURN TO OHSWEKEN SPEEDWAY’S 602 SPRINT CAR SERIES
Following a strong showing in his first season of racing the 602 Crate Sprints at Ohsweken, Jake Brown is looking forwarded to an even better season in 2015.
Last year he won two A-Main events at the 3/8th-mile oval, finished third in the developmental division points and added another win in a special late season appearance at South Buxton Raceway south of Chatham.
With aspirations of eventually moving up to the 360 Sprints he’s aware of the increased demands required to compete in the highly competitive level of open-wheel racing and is determined to prove he’s got what it takes to race with his brother in the near future.
Although most of his racing will be at Ohsweken Speedway in 2015 he also hopes to find other events to compete in.
